Bio

2010 is my first attempt at FAWM. Every other year, I have been busy adjusting to new jobs. This year, I figure my whole life could just slip away adjusting to new jobs, so what the hell. Here goes!

I came to FAWM through connections in 50songs90days in Yahoo Groups, which I re-established after the original 50 Songs in 90 Days Challenge shut down with the help of some other 'crazy' challengees. We just had to keep the idea going. Bill Chin and dvc have been my co-moderators ever since and in 2008 (or 2007?) Monty (L Montgomery) and Tim Wille (snogledk etc...) joined the ranks of moderation. (Take that any way you like but remember there could be a dose of irony wink

Generously offered the option of the 50/90ERS FAWM site, the 50songs90days group concensus has been to spread our wings. Tim Wille was the main mover and shaker in negotiating this. So he is responsible for me being here! Blame it on him! lol

Predominantly a lyric writer, I am entering a new chapter in cyber-songwriting! In the 2009 5090 Challenge, I actually recorded - and uploaded - some of my own stuff.
